1.What is Vietnam Electronic Visa (eVisa)?

Vietnam Electronic Visa, also known as Vietnam eVisa (symbol: EV), was introduced by the Vietnam Immigration Department on February 2, 2017. Vietnam eVisa is applied for and issued online. The visa has a maximum validity of 90 days and can be chosen for single or multiple entries. Passport holders from countries and regions worldwide are eligible to apply.

 

2. What information will be on the Vietnam Electronic Visa?

Your Vietnam Electronic Visa (eVisa) will contain the following detailed information:

• Full name of the eVisa holder, date of birth, gender, nationality, passport number, passport expiration date

• Travel dates (visa validity period)

• Port of entry

• Purpose of entry

• Inviting/guaranteeing agency/organization and their address, phone number (if applicable)

• A unique QR code that, when scanned, displays some details of the eVisa holder, including passport number and nationality.

It will not have a red seal from the Vietnamese government because it is issued online, and the information will match that in the Vietnam government's immigration system.

4. What documents are required to apply for a eVisa?

If you are eligible for a Vietnam electronic visa, you will need to provide the following information during the application process:

  • Applicant's nationality
  • Port of entry
  • Arrival date
  • Passport number
  • Passport validity (must have at least 6 months remaining validity and at least two blank pages)
  • Personal identification photo (passport-sized) (refer to Vietnam visa photo requirements)
  • Passport personal information page photo
  • Credit card for online payment of the electronic visa fee

5.Ports allowing foreigners to enter and exit Vietnam with an eVisa

Holders of Vietnam eVisas can enter the country through any of the following 33 ports:

Airports Landports Seaports
Noi Bai Airport (Hanoi) Tay Trang Border Gate (Dien Bien) Hon Gai Seaport (Quang Ninh)
Tan Son Nhat Airport (Ho Chi Minh City) Mong Cai Border Gate (Quang Ninh) Cam Pha Seaport (Quang Ninh)
Cam Ranh Airport (Khanh Hoa) Huu Nghi Border Gate (Lang Son) Hai Phong Seaport (Hai Phong)
Da Nang Airport (Da Nang) Lao Cai Border Gate (Lao Cai) Vung Ang Seaport (Ha Tinh)
Cat Bi Airport (Hai Phong) Na Meo Border Gate (Thanh Hoa) Chan May Seaport (Thua Thien Hue)
Can Tho Airport (Can Tho) Nam Can Border Gate (Nghe An) Da Nang Seaport (Da Nang)
Phu Quoc Airport (Kien Giang) Cau Treo Border Gate (Ha Tinh) Nha Trang Seaport (Khanh Hoa)
Phu Bai Airport (Thua Thien Hue) Cha Lo Border Gate (Quang Binh) Quy Nhon Seaport (Binh Dinh)
Van Don Airport (Quang Ninh) La Lay Border Gate (Quang Tri) Dung Quat Seaport (Quang Ngai)
Tho Xuan Airport (Thanh Hoa) Lao Bao Border Gate (Quang Tri) Vung Tau Seaport (Ba Ria-Vung Tau)
Dong Hoi Airport (Quang Binh) Bo Y Border Gate (Kon Tum) Ho Chi Minh City Seaport (Ho Chi Minh City)
Phu Cat Airport (Binh Dinh) Moc Bai Border Gate (Tay Ninh) Duong Dong Seaport (Kien Giang)
Lien Khuong Airport (Lam Dong) Xa Mat Border Gate (Tay Ninh)  
  Tinh Bien Border Gate (An Giang)  
  Vinh Xuong Land and Waterway Border Gate (An Giang)  
  Ha Tien Border Gate (Kien Giang)  

 

Note:

When applying for a visa, it is essential to provide the correct port of entry. Entering Vietnam through a port that is not approved on your visa may result in possible rejection.

6. Visa Processing Time

How long does it take to process a eVisa? Generally, it takes 5-7 business days (Vietnam time = GMT+7, excluding Saturdays, Sundays, and Vietnam public holidays) to receive the electronic visa letter. However, the processing time may be affected by a high volume of applicants or holidays. Therefore, it is advisable to apply for such a visa 1-2 weeks before your departure.
